Output 3daf029a28267ebb30382fd9f90a9309193458d26abc69bb869e20c0dbf38767:3

value
317491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 369ece4cecf71509cd9ce7766bfab68f5675bf63 OP_EQUAL
address
36fpevjcpWR4bPJ94ie44EeyU21HE2tbFn
transaction
3daf029a28267ebb30382fd9f90a9309193458d26abc69bb869e20c0dbf38767
spent
true